检查MySQL的错误日志文件,通常位于/var/log/mysql/error.log(Linux)或C:\ProgramData\MySQL\MySQL Server 5.7\data\error.log(Windows),具体位置取决于你的操作系统和安装配置。错误日志会包含详细的错误信息,帮助你了解问题所在。 检查连接问题: 如果遇到类似错误2003或2002,这通常意味着客户端无法连接到MySQL服务器。
检查数据库状态:有时候数据库可能处于不稳定的状态,可以尝试重启数据库服务或者修复数据库表。 查看日志文件:如果以上方法都没有解决问题,可以查看MySQL的错误日志文件,看看是否有更详细的错误信息,从而找到解决方法。 如果以上方法都无法解决问题,可以尝试搜索相关的错误信息,查看MySQL官方文档或者向MySQL社区寻求帮助。 0...
如果是在本地连接,确保使用的是localhost或127.0.0.1。 5. 检查 MySQL 日志 查看MySQL 错误日志: 查看MySQL 的错误日志文件,通常位于/var/log/mysql/error.log或/var/lib/mysql/hostname.err。 使用tail -f命令查看实时日志: bash tail-f /var/log/mysql/error.log 6. 检查 MySQL 配置文件 检查MySQL 配置文...
1、错误:无法连接到MySQL服务器: 解决方法: 确保MySQL服务器正在运行。 检查MySQL服务器的网络配置和防火墙设置,确保可以从客户端访问。 使用正确的主机名、端口号、用户名和密码尝试连接。 2、错误:访问被拒绝: 解决方法: 检查MySQL用户的权限设置,确保用户具有适当的权限以访问所需的数据库和表。
ERROR 2003 (HY000): Can't connect to MySQL server on 'localhost:3306' (10061) 解决方案 1.在命令行窗口,输入: netstat -ano 在cmd命令里输入“netstat -ano”查看端口使用情况。这时你应该找不到3306这个端口号: C:\Windows\System32>netstat -ano ...
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O) 1.说明root用户没有权限,首先修改/etc/my.cnf,在[mysqld]下面添加skip-grant-tables 2.保存退出后,重启MySQL服务:systemctl restart mysqld 3.然后进入MySQL客户端,执行:flush privileges; ...
1 停止mysql服务:右键点击“我的电脑”图标,出现右键菜单后左键点击“管理”。弹出“电脑管理”对话框后,左键点击“服务与程序”,接着点击“服务”,最后找到mysql服务并将其关闭。2 进入控制面板,点击卸载程序,进入卸载程序对话框后卸载mysql。3 组合键W+R进入运行,输入“regedit”,查看下面 HKEY_LOCAL...
方法五:检查 MySQL 客户端连接参数 如果以上方法都无法解决问题,那么可能是 MySQL 客户端连接参数有误。请确保连接参数正确无误,包括用户名、密码、主机名、端口号和数据库名称等。 总结 通过以上几种方法,我们可以解决 “ERROR 2003 (HY000): Can’t connect to MySQL server on ‘localhost’” 错误。首先,确保...
mysqli_errno错误代码 mysql error! 最近迁移项目中发现,转移数据库出现的几个问题,其中之一就是 2006 error,解决过程如下: 首先贴出报错结果 [Msg] Finished - Unsuccessfully 出现这个结果,首先检查SQL文件查看当前编码,将编码改为:以utf8无bom格式编码。